Mary Backus and I went for the Scissor-tailed Flycatcher this afternoon and found it on the wire along Hwy E, about 1/4 "south" of intersection of Hwy E and Hwy O at around 3:15 p.m. We raced back to the spot where all the other birders have been seeing it at to tell Kay Kavanagh and her husband, and one other birder there. We all went back to this new spot and saw the bird out in the field on the west side of the road, but for only several seconds before it took flight again and flew to the south behind some trees next to the white house. We lost sight of it after that, and searched the area over as best we could for at least an hour with no luck. At one point Mary and I went down the road where the Western Kingbird was reported at, but at the time we didn't know about this sighting and did not see this bird either.
